## Deploying the Gatewick Proctor Queue

Deploys are pretty painless: push to main, wait for the pipeline, then watch the queue drain dashboard for five minutes. If candidates pile up mid-exam, roll back first and ask questions later — the queue replays safely. Everything the workers care about lives in one config block, shown here for reference.

settings of bafof-yagef:
JOROX_PIN=8740
JOROX_TENANT=pelox
JOROX_METRICS_HOST=metrics.jorox.qorvelworks.internal
JOROX_SEAL=seal_c78f63c1
JOROX_STANDBY_TEAM=norax

Subject: Turnstile counter cut-over summary

Hi Dorit,

The cut-over of the Gatewick turnstile counter at Fennmore Stadium completed last night. We ran old and new counters in parallel for three home events; totals matched within 0.02%, attributable to a known debounce difference documented in the migration notes. The legacy poller is now disabled and the new service is the source of record. For your review, the settings the service came up with are listed below.

service settings:
pelath:
  pin: 5871
  tenant: belox
  seal: seal_d5a7bfb2
  metrics_host: metrics.pelath.qorvelcorp.test
  standby_team: oliys
  escalation: kelath-nordor
  nonce: 338058

Marrow Fabrication now represents 41% of quarterly revenue, up from 28% a year ago. Their contract renews in eight months, and any reduction in their orders would materially affect cash flow forecasts. I have documented mitigation steps, including the diversification pipeline and revised credit terms, in the shared ledger. Please review the dependency analysis carefully. The board's confidential direction on this matter appears below.

board note of fahif-yahog: Gross margin on Wenath came in at 10 percent against a plan of 5 percent. Only 3 of the 100 pilot accounts renewed Wenath, so a churn review is set for July 15.